Wer ist online

Gäste online: 3
Mitglieder online: 0

Letzte Mitglieder
21Matze
Offline
djmartin
Offline
Rene Weber
Offline
Harlekin
Offline
Black2019
Offline
JG75
Offline
schnuff
Offline
Nazaret...
Offline
jochimi...
Offline
Richy
Offline
Mehr anzeigen


Wir suchen...

Moderator
Gast Moderator
Spezial Moderator
DJ
Chat Wache
Sponsor
Techniker
Grafiker

Jetzt Bewerben!

Shoutbox

Du musst eingeloggt sein um eine Nachricht zu schreiben.

Michael71
Michael71
aus
08. August 2023 17:02
Offline
Verwarnstatus: warningwarningwarningwarning
hallo suche PHP

Layout-24
Layout-24
aus
01. Januar 2022 18:37
Offline
Verwarnstatus: warningwarningwarningwarning
Wir von layout-24 wünschen euch ein frohes neues Jahr 2022. Bleibt gesund.

Rico1993
Rico1993
aus
24. November 2021 22:32
Offline
Verwarnstatus: warningwarningwarningwarning
Suche Weihnachten Design für PHP 9.10.10

Shoutbox Archiv

Shoutbox Beiträge: 530
©


Thema ansehen

PHPFusion-4you.de » PHP-Fusion v7 -Hilfe und Support » Allgemeine Fragen und Probleme für V7
 Thema drucken
einbinden von Shoutcast Streams in Theme Fiirefly
DJ In Extremo
Hallo Liebe Gemeinde,

und zwar versuche ich seit Stunden schon im Theme Firefly eine Doppelstreambox einzubauen bzw zwei Streams.

Mein Problem ist die 1. nimmt er an. Aber den zweiten Stream nicht.

Hier der code aus der theme.php

Download PHP Code  PHP
  1. <?php
  2. //Header
  3. echo "    
  4. <table cellpadding='0' cellspacing='0' border='1' width='1000' height='270' align='center' background='"&#46;THEME&#46;"images/banner&#46;png'><tr><td>
  5. <object type='application/x-shockwave-flash' data='"&#46;THEME&#46;"images/fire&#46;swf' width='250' height='250' align='left' valign='top'>
  6. <param name='movie' value='"&#46;THEME&#46;"images/fire&#46;swf' /><param name='wmode' value='transparent' /></object>
  7. </td></tr>";
  8.   echo"<tr>";
  9.         echo"<td width='500'>";
  10.         include THEME&#46;"stream/streamstats&#46;php";
  11.         echo"</td>";
  12.         echo"<td class='h105'></td>";
  13.     echo"</tr>";
  14.     echo"<tr>";
  15.         echo"<td colspan='2' align='right'>";
  16.         echo"<a href='/themes/Radio_DJ_GIRL_v1&#46;2/stream/listen&#46;asx'><img src='"&#46;THEME&#46;"images/mediaplayer&#46;png' width='30px' height='30px'></a>&nbsp;";
  17.         echo"<a href='/themes/Radio_DJ_GIRL_v1&#46;2/stream/listen&#46;pls'><img src='"&#46;THEME&#46;"images/winamp&#46;png' width='30px' height='30px'></a>&nbsp;";
  18.         echo"<a href='#RADIO PLAYER DATEI'><img src='"&#46;THEME&#46;"images/flash&#46;png' width='30px' height='30px'></a>&nbsp;";
  19.   echo"<td width='500'>";
  20.         include THEME&#46;"stream/streamstats2&#46;php";
  21.         echo"</td>";
  22.         echo"<td></td>";
  23.     echo"</tr>";
  24.     echo"<tr>";
  25.         echo"<td colspan='2' align='right'>";
  26.         echo"<a href='/themes/Radio_DJ_GIRL_v1&#46;2/stream/listen&#46;asx'><img src='"&#46;THEME&#46;"images/mediaplayer&#46;png' width='30px' height='30px'></a>&nbsp;";
  27.         echo"<a href='/themes/Radio_DJ_GIRL_v1&#46;2/stream/listen&#46;pls'><img src='"&#46;THEME&#46;"images/winamp&#46;png' width='30px' height='30px'></a>&nbsp;";
  28.         echo"<a href='#RADIO PLAYER DATEI'><img src='"&#46;THEME&#46;"images/flash&#46;png' width='30px' height='30px'></a>&nbsp;";
  29.   echo"</table>";
  30. ?>


Link zur HP: http://fusion.mag...e-radio.de

irgendwer nen Schlaufen vorschlag wie ich dies lösen könnte?

Lg

Dommi aka DJ In Extremo
 
http://fusion.magic-sunrise-radio.deWeb
TaZzOo
Download PHP Code  PHP
  1. <?php
  2. //Header
  3. echo "    
  4. <table cellpadding='0' cellspacing='0' border='1' width='1000' height='270' align='center' background='"&#46;THEME&#46;"images/banner&#46;png'><tr><td>
  5. <object type='application/x-shockwave-flash' data='"&#46;THEME&#46;"images/fire&#46;swf' width='250' height='250' align='left' valign='top'>
  6. <param name='movie' value='"&#46;THEME&#46;"images/fire&#46;swf' /><param name='wmode' value='transparent' /></object>
  7. </td></tr>";
  8.   echo"<tr>";
  9.         echo"<td width='500'>";
  10.         include THEME&#46;"stream/streamstats&#46;php";
  11.         echo"</td>";
  12.         echo"<td class='h105'></td>";
  13.     echo"</tr>";
  14.     echo"<tr>";
  15.         echo"<td colspan='2' align='right'>";
  16.        echo"<tr>";
  17.         echo"<td width='478' height='104'><p>";include THEME&#46;"stream/streamstats21&#46;php";echo"</td>";
  18. echo"<p>player</p>
  19.             <p>player</p>
  20.             <p>player;</p>
  21.             <p>player</td>";
  22.         echo"<td width='478" height='104'><p>";include THEME&#46;"stream/streamstats2&#46;php";echo"</td>";
  23. echo"<p>player</p>
  24.             <p>player</p>
  25.             <p>player;</p>
  26.             <p>player</td>";
  27.     echo"</tr>";
  28.    
  29. ?>


Bin Zwar kein Profi aber versuch es mal so grössen der tabelle muss du noch anpassen und ausrichten aber normal ist es garnicht so schwer mit den includen müsste es eigentlich gehen
 
http://tazzoo-world.de/testingWeb
Septron
Hallo,

ich schätze mal der die Zweite Stream sich mit dem Ersten durch Identische Abfrage Beisst...

LG Septron
 
https://www.septron.deWeb
DJ In Extremo

>Septron schrieb:


Hallo,

ich schätze mal der die Zweite Stream sich mit dem Ersten durch Identische Abfrage Beisst...

LG Septron


Joa Dennis ne idee wie ich das lösen kann? =D

Lg Dommi
 
http://fusion.magic-sunrise-radio.deWeb
Septron
Hallo,

ich denke mir mal das deine Streamabfrage von beiden so ausschaut:

Download Code  Code
$scast_host = '***';
    $scast_name = '***';
    $scast_port = '***';
    $scast_pass = '***';




es sollte aber so aussehen:

Datei 1:
Download Code  Code
$scast_host = '***';
    $scast_name = '***';
    $scast_port = '***';
    $scast_pass = '***';




Datei 2:
Download Code  Code
$scast_host2 = '***';
    $scast_name2 = '***';
    $scast_port2 = '***';
    $scast_pass2 = '***';




die anderen Bereich wirst du dann schon schnell erkennen

hier dann nochmal 2 Beispiele:

Datei 1:
Download Code  Code
// XML holen
    if($fp = @fsockopen($scast_host, $scast_port, $errno, $errstr, 30)) {
        if(fputs($fp, "GET /admin.cgi?pass=".$scast_pass."&mode=viewxml HTTP/1.0\r\nUser-Agent: XML Getter (Mozilla Compatible)\r\n\r\n")) {
            $xmldata = "";
            while(!feof($fp)) $xmldata .= fgets($fp, 1000)
            $xmldata = explode("\r\n", $xmldata)
            $xmldata = $xmldata[3];
        }
    }


// Regex Funktionen
    function get_item($name, $source) {
        preg_match('#<'.$name.'>(.*?)</'.$name.'>#', $source, $matches)
        return $matches[1];
    }
    function get_items($name, $source) {
        preg_match_all('#<'.$name.'>(.*?)</'.$name.'>#', $source, $matches)
        return $matches[1];
    }


// Werte aus XML auslesen
    $sc_stream_status = get_item("STREAMSTATUS", $xmldata)
   
    if($sc_stream_status) {
      $sc_stream_bitrate = get_item("BITRATE", $xmldata)
        $sc_server_title   = get_item("SERVERTITLE", $xmldata)
        $sc_current_song   = get_item("SONGTITLE", $xmldata)
        $sc_server_genre   = get_item("SERVERGENRE", $xmldata)
    }
    #echo "<h2><center><sho2>ClubLine</sho2></center></h2>";
    if(!($sc_stream_bitrate)) {
        echo "<sho>Status: </sho><sho2>Offline</sho2>";
    }
    else {
############################################
            
            $ausgabe1 = "".$sc_current_song."";
            $ausgabe4= "".$sc_server_title."";




Datei 2:
Download Code  Code
// Viewmodis




// XML holen
    if($fp = @fsockopen($scast_host2, $scast_port2, $errno, $errstr, 30)) {
        if(fputs($fp, "GET /admin.cgi?pass=".$scast_pass2."&mode=viewxml HTTP/1.0\r\nUser-Agent: XML Getter (Mozilla Compatible)\r\n\r\n")) {
            $xmldata = "";
            while(!feof($fp)) $xmldata .= fgets($fp, 1000)
            $xmldata = explode("\r\n", $xmldata)
            $xmldata = $xmldata[3];
        }
    }


// Regex Funktionen
    function get_item2($name, $source) {
        preg_match('#<'.$name.'>(.*?)</'.$name.'>#', $source, $matches)
        return $matches[1];
    }
    function get_items2($name, $source) {
        preg_match_all('#<'.$name.'>(.*?)</'.$name.'>#', $source, $matches)
        return $matches[1];
    }


// Werte aus XML auslesen
    $sc_stream_status2 = get_item2("STREAMSTATUS", $xmldata)
   
    if($sc_stream_status2) {
      $sc_stream_bitrate2 = get_item2("BITRATE", $xmldata)
        $sc_server_title2   = get_item2("SERVERTITLE", $xmldata)
        $sc_current_song2   = get_item2("SONGTITLE", $xmldata)
        $sc_server_genre2   = get_item("SERVERGENRE", $xmldata)
    }
    #echo "<h2><center><sho2>HardLine</sho2></center></h2>";
    if(!($sc_stream_bitrate2)) {
        echo "<sho>Status: </sho><sho2>Offline</sho2>";
    }
    else {
            ############################################
            
            $ausgabe2 = "".$sc_current_song2."";
            $onair13= "".$sc_server_title2."";





Den Rest wirst dann schon lösen können
mehr Beispiele braucht man nun nicht mehr....

LG Septron
 
https://www.septron.deWeb
DJ In Extremo
Vielen Lieben Dank Dennis. ich werds dann gleich mal ausprobieren ^^
 
http://fusion.magic-sunrise-radio.deWeb

Thema verlinken
Soziale Netzwerke: Facebook Google Windows-Live Twitter Yahoo
URL:
BBcode:
HTML:
Facebook Like:


Springe ins Forum:

Ähnliche Themen

Thema Forum Antworten Letzter Beitrag
silvester Theme Themes und Design V7 2 10. Dezember 2019 12:11
Farbe Theme Themes und Design V7 3 24. April 2019 05:03
Weihnachtliches Theme Themes und Design V7 2 14. Dezember 2018 04:44
Suche ein Theme für unsere ETS2. Themes und Design V7 3 18. Juni 2018 22:25
Bräuchte einen Theme-Designer Suche Themes 5 03. Juni 2018 23:14